Bowler, Wi vs Penticton, Bc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Bowler, Wi, Usa and Penticton, Bc, Canada is approximately 2,346 km or 1,458 mi.
  • To reach Bowler, Wi in this distance one would set out from Penticton, Bc bearing 90.5°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Bowler, Wi bearing 113.2° or ESE .
  • Bowler, Wi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Penticton, Bc has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
  • Bowler, Wi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Penticton, Bc is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 4.4 °C (7.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.9 °C (17.8°F) more in Bowler, Wi.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 489.6 mm (19.3 in) more which is equivalent to 489.6 l/m² (12.02 US gal/ft²) or 4,896,000 l/ha (523,415 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.4° higher in Bowler, Wi than in Penticton, Bc.
